Descubra los secretos de uno de los algoritmos criptográficos más influyentes en el mundo de las criptomonedas: Scrypt. Como parte de la serie “Criptomoneda Litecoin”, este libro profundiza en los componentes críticos que han dado forma al panorama criptográfico e impulsado el auge de las criptomonedas. Ya sea profesional, entusiasta, estudiante de posgrado o simplemente alguien con curiosidad por la criptografía, este libro le proporciona conocimientos esenciales para mejorar su comprensión de Scrypt y sus aplicaciones.
Resumen breve de los capítulos:
1: Scrypt: Fundamentos del algoritmo de prueba de trabajo de Litecoin, centrado en su diseño de memoria dura.
2: Cracking de contraseñas: Explora técnicas para vulnerar contraseñas cifradas y cómo Scrypt las resiste.
3: Función de derivación de claves: Investiga métodos para generar claves criptográficas de forma segura a partir de contraseñas.
4: Tabla arcoíris: Analiza el método de ataque contra el que Scrypt se protege, garantizando la seguridad de las contraseñas.
5: Adler32: Presenta la función de suma de comprobación y su papel en la integridad de los datos y la seguridad criptográfica. 6: Ataque de diccionario: Explica cómo los atacantes usan listas de palabras precompiladas para descifrar contraseñas débiles.
7: Protección de contraseñas de Microsoft Office: Detalla cómo Scrypt puede fortalecer la seguridad de las contraseñas contra ataques comunes.
8: HMAC: Un método utilizado para verificar la integridad y autenticidad de un mensaje, reforzando la seguridad de Scrypt.
9: Pepper (criptografía): Describe la función de usar peppering en las contraseñas para mejorar la seguridad en los algoritmos de hash.
10: Blowfish (cifrado): Un algoritmo de cifrado simétrico analizado en relación con los mecanismos de seguridad de Scrypt.
11: Mecanismo de autenticación de desafío-respuesta con sal: Explora cómo el salting añade una capa adicional de seguridad a Scrypt.
12: Contraseña maestra (algoritmo): Un análisis de algoritmos de contraseñas seguras relacionados con la robustez de Scrypt.
13: Bcrypt: Presenta otro algoritmo de hash y lo compara con Scrypt en términos de seguridad.
14: PBKDF2: Análisis a fondo de una función de derivación de claves y comparación de las propiedades de memoria de Scrypt.
15: Lyra2: Un algoritmo moderno utilizado en la minería de criptomonedas, comparado con Scrypt en eficiencia computacional.
16: Función hash criptográfica: Una visión general de las funciones hash criptográficas y la contribución de Scrypt al campo.
17: Prueba de trabajo: Explica el concepto de prueba de trabajo, donde Scrypt desempeña un papel fundamental en la minería de Litecoin.
18: BLAKE (función hash): Una función hash criptográfica más reciente y su aplicación en algoritmos seguros como Scrypt.
19: Extensión de claves: Un método para aumentar el esfuerzo computacional necesario para romper el cifrado, fundamental para la función de Scrypt.
20: Crypt ©: Un algoritmo de cifrado ligero y su relación con funciones de memoria como Scrypt.
21: Argon2: Un algoritmo de hash de vanguardia y su comparación con Scrypt en cuanto a resistencia a ataques.
Este libro es más que una simple exploración de Scrypt; es una puerta de entrada para comprender cómo los algoritmos criptográficos impulsan la seguridad de criptomonedas como Litecoin. Con detalles de vanguardia, promete educar y dotar a los lectores de los conocimientos necesarios para prosperar en el cambiante mundo de las monedas digitales. Profesionales, estudiantes y entusiastas encontrarán un inmenso valor en esta guía concisa pero completa.